$15M Sales Tax Rebate Row Shot Down By Texas High Court

By Jonathan Randles (June 27, 2014, 5:00 PM EDT) -- The Texas Supreme Court refused Friday to take up an appeal that sought to revive a consumer class action against the state for attempting to recover $14.6 million in sales tax, which the plaintiffs claimed they shouldn't have needed to pay on rebates offered by Best Buy Co. Inc. and other retailers....
